boost problems
On the weekend i installed a new (china) exhaust, now it was running fine that arvo but the next day it felt like it wasnt making full boost.
I dont have a boost guage yet but i took it too maximum motorsport and they plugeed there laptop in and took it for a drive and he told me its only making 10.5 pounds my car is a my02 STI the only other mod is a pod filter has anyone got any ideas y this could be happening? any help would be appreciated cheers pete |

Is it a full TBE? If yes, then the ECU will chuck a spaz and revert into limp mode and retard ignition timings.
In limp mode the boost is set at whatever your wastegate actuator is set for. You will need minimum ECUTEK ECU modification to get the most out of your new exhaust.
